Discover Family-Friendly Aquariums Near Lawton

If you’re looking for family-friendly aquariums near Lawton, you’ll find some fantastic options just a short drive away. The Oklahoma Aquarium in Jenks is a must-visit, showcasing a diverse array of marine life and interactive exhibits that will captivate both kids and adults. If you’re up for a bit of travel, the Sea Life Kansas City Aquarium, about two hours away, offers immersive experiences with countless sea creatures and hands-on activities that make learning fun.
Closer to home, the Oklahoma City Zoo and Botanical Garden features a small aquarium section focused on local aquatic ecosystems, perfect for young children. While the Great Plains Wildlife Park highlights land animals, it still gives you a chance to spot local aquatic wildlife. For an unforgettable adventure, don’t miss the Texas State Aquarium in Corpus Christi. Unique Animal Experiences
What makes the Oklahoma Aquarium a must-visit destination for families? It’s all about the unique animal experiences that immerse you in the wonders of marine life. Here are some highlights:
- Interactive marine encounters: Get hands-on with stingrays in the touch tank.
- Unique feeding sessions: Watch as divers feed sharks right before your eyes.
- Behind the scenes tours: Explore areas usually off-limits and learn how the aquarium cares for its inhabitants.
- Shark Adventure: Walk through a tunnel surrounded by swimming sharks and other sea creatures.
These experiences not only entertain but also educate, making your visit both fun and memorable. Whether you’re a child or an adult, there’s something here to ignite your love for the ocean!

Supervision for Young Children
Steering through the vibrant world of an aquarium can be an exhilarating experience for families, but it’s essential to keep young children under close supervision. Crowded spaces and fascinating exhibits can pose safety risks, so stay alert. Use designated viewing areas to minimize the chance of little ones leaning too far over barriers. Child supervision tips like harnesses or wristbands can help keep them secure and easily identifiable. Engage your kids by explaining safety rules and the importance of gentle behavior around marine life. Look for aquariums offering family-friendly amenities, like stroller rentals and child-safe play areas, to enhance your visit while ensuring their safety.
